The polyamide membrane filter has hydrophilicity and chemical resistance to alkaline solutions and organic solvents. Therefore, it is recommended to remove particles from aqueous solutions and solvents for analytical determination, such as HPLC.

Bubble Point | 3.2 bar |
---|---|
Burst Pressure | > 0.25 bar |
Color | (Membrane) white (w/o grid) |
Delivery Condition | Non-Sterile |
Diameter | ⌀ 142 mm |
Flow Rate Range | 15 mL/min/cm2/bar (Water) |
Format | (Filter) Discs |
Material | (Membrane) Polyamide (PA) |
Packaging | Non-sterile, bulk packed |
Pack Size | 100 |
Pore Dimensions | 0.2 µm |
Sterilization | By autoclaving at 121 °C or 134°C Ethylene oxide |
Thickness | (Membrane) 115 µm |
Type | Membrane Filters |
Wettability | Hydrophilic |
